New lineup of Barclays Wyndham cards

I didn't see this anywhere here or in the Wyndham sub. Apologies for TPG, I know that triggers some of you:

Wyndham Rewards Earner Card



Sign-up bonus: 30,000 points after spending $1,000 on purchases in the first 90 days.

Earning structure: 5x on Hotels by Wyndham purchases and gas purchases, 2x on restaurants and grocery (excluding Target and Walmart), 2x on eligible purchases made at Wyndham Timeshare properties (including maintenance fees and loan payments), 1x on all other purchases

Annual fee: $0

Other benefits: Gold status in Wyndham Rewards, 7,500 bonus points after $15,000 in annual spend, 10% discount on the number of points redeemed for free nights

Wyndham Rewards Earner Plus Card



Sign-up bonus: 45,000 points after spending $1,000 on purchases in the first 90 days.
Earning structure: 6x on Hotels by Wyndham purchases and gas purchases, 4x on restaurants and grocery (excluding Target and Walmart), 4x on Wyndham Timeshare properties (including maintenance fees and loan payments), 1x on all other purchases

Annual fee: $75 (not waived first year)

Other benefits: Platinum status in Wyndham Rewards, 7,500 bonus points each anniversary year (no spending requirement) and 10% discount on the number of points redeemed for free nights

Wyndham Rewards Earner Business Card



Sign-up bonus: 45,000 points after spending $1,000 on purchases in the first 90 days.

Earning structure: 8x on Hotels by Wyndham purchases and gas purchases, 5x points on marketing, advertising and utilities, 1x on all other purchases

Annual Fee: $95 (not waived first year)

Other benefits: Top-tier Diamond status in Wyndham Rewards, 15,000 anniversary points (no spending requirement), 10% discount on the number of points redeemed for free nights, cell phone insurance when using the card to pay your wireless bill ($50 deductible, $600 in coverage per event)

These look like really good sock-drawer cards even if you don't regularly stay at Wyndham properties, in particular the earner+ and business version, and they're not terrible gas cards either. Plus they're all 0% foreign transaction fee so they're a decent backup for overseas if you're primarily Amex. With the anniversary points you can basically cover the annual fee if you go for an above-average redemption, especially the business version which only costs $20 more than the earner+ but yields twice as many anniversary points. It's also interesting that the business version has notably more lucrative perks and bonus spend than the higher-tier personal card yet they all have low MSR for the SUB. Also if I'm not mistaken you can still match from Wyndham to Caesars which means the business version which awards Wyndham Diamond can get you Caesars Diamond (no resort fees, discounted stays, etc.).

The only downside obviously is that it's Barclays.
